Abstract
Novel methods are disclosed for designing and constructing miniature optical systems and devices employing light diffractive optical elements (DOEs) for modifying the size and shape of laser beams produced from a commercial-grade laser diodes, over an extended range hitherto unachievable using conventional techniques. The systems and devices of the present invention have uses in a wide range of applications, including laser scanning, optical-based information storage, medical and analytical instrumentation, and the like. In the illustrative embodiments, various techniques are disclosed for implementing the DOEs as holographic optical elements (HOEs), computer-generated holograms (CGHs), as well as other diffractive optical elements.

84. A laser beam producing system comprises:
-
a laser beam source, such as a visible laser diode (VLD), for producing a laser beam from its junction;
a collimating lens (L1) for collimating the laser beam as it is transmitted through collimating lens L1 and through the system in a P-incident manner;
a fixed spatial-frequency diffractive optical element (DOE) denotable by D1;
a fixed spatial-frequency diffractive optical element (DOE) denotable by D2; and
a focusing lens (L2) disposed between DOE D1 and DOE D2 and adjustably translatable along its optical axis during the alignment stage of the system assembly process for focusing the output laser beam to some point in space. - View Dependent Claims (85, 86, 87, 88, 89)
